Compare all specifications:
2005 Ford Escape | 1997 Toyota Avensis | |
Make | Ford | Toyota |
Model | Escape | Avensis |
Year Released | 2005 | 1997 |
Body Type | SUV | Sedan |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1988 cc | 1762 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 124 HP | 109 HP |
Engine RPM | 5500 RPM | 5600 RPM |
Torque | 168 Nm | 155 Nm |
Torque RPM | 4500 RPM | 2800 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 84.8 mm | 81 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 88 mm | 85.5 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 10.0:1 | 9.5:1 |
Drive Type | 4WD |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Automatic |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 5 doors | 4 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1470 kg | 1200 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4400 mm | 4500 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1790 mm | 1720 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1760 mm | 1430 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2580 mm | 2640 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 59 L | 60 L |
